This pregnancy I have been incredibly more sore than with the other two.
Not sure if it is how the baby is positioned..
or if it’s something with my sciatic nerve or possibly symphysis pubis..
but I am in PAIN.
I went to a chiropractor but am going to ask my doctor about
getting a script to see a physical therapist. It comes and goes..
but is more and more becoming constant pain.
I can’t put pressure on my right leg, If I sit/stand/lay in one position for
long then move I jolt in pain. The times it is worse is when I try
to walk short distances and then bend over to pick something up like a child..
or a toy..something I do only a million times a day……… ;)
There have been a couple times I’ve been out..and couldn’t walk to my car
and had to wait a bit to stand still and hope it “stretches” out.
I can only imagine that it’ll get worse as the baby load gets heavier.
I might see if I can get a hip stabilizer..was told that could help!
You know it’s bad when you crawl to your room because it hurts too much to walk!
Pretty sure I blogged about this pain already..but It’s gotten pretty bad.
The chiropractor said that it’ll probably go away as soon as the baby is born..
so going to try and hang in there till it’s D-Day!
